Banknote description

This banknote is a 50 Mark issued in Estonia in 1919. It belongs to the 50 Mark series and falls within the period of Treasury and Bank Notes of 1918–1923.

The note is cataloged under Pick number 55. Its classification includes design features such as an olive underprint on the front side and a globe at the center of the back. Additionally, it exhibits horizontal and vertical light line watermark varieties. The banknote is primarily brown in color.

About this banknote

The Republic of Estonia issued the 50 Marka banknote in 1919, during the early years of its independence. This series was introduced to establish a national currency following Estonia's declaration of independence in 1918. The banknotes were printed by Tilgmann Lithography in Finland.

The front of the note features a design of waves on an olive underprint, while the reverse displays a globe at the center. The banknote measures 140 x 86 mm and lacks a security thread. Watermark varieties include horizontal and vertical light lines. Signatures on the note are those of Eduard Aule and Johan Sihver. The note was demonetized on March 1, 1924.
